Set in the heart of Christchurch, the Botanic Gardens are a serene 21-hectare oasis showcasing a stunning array of native and exotic plants. Established in 1863, these gardens offer a peaceful escape with lush lawns, meandering riverbanks, and themed collections that reflect Canterbury's botanical heritage.

Suggested Time to Spend

Half a day is ideal to explore the gardens at a leisurely pace, allowing time for a picnic or coffee. If you're short on time, a focused one-hour walk through the highlights is possible. The gardens are free and open daily, so you can easily combine them with a morning visit to the Canterbury Museum (adjacent).
